Subject: Re: [PATCH net v1 3/3] [RFC] mac80211: ieee80211_store_ack_skb():
 make use of skb_clone_sk_optional()

On Mon, 2021-02-22 at 19:51 +0100, Marc Kleine-Budde wrote:
> On 22.02.2021 17:30:59, Johannes Berg wrote:
> > On Mon, 2021-02-22 at 16:12 +0100, Oleksij Rempel wrote:
> > > This code is trying to clone the skb with optional skb->sk. But this
> > > will fail to clone the skb if socket was closed just after the skb was
> > > pushed into the networking stack.
> > 
> > Which IMHO is completely fine. If we then still clone the SKB we can't
> > do anything with it, since the point would be to ... send it back to the
> > socket, but it's gone.
> 
> Ok, but why is the skb cloned if there is no socket linked in skb->sk?

Hm? There are two different ways to get here, one with and one without a
socket.
